This week on another episode of The Sassenach Files, Chelsea is talking all things 707: “A Practical Guide for Time Travelers”. So grab a wee dram, and pull up a chair as she discusses the humor Margot Ye weaved into the script as well as the character oriented direction from Joss Agnew. She also chats about Buck’s rehabilitation as a character, the necessity of William losing Sandy, and Rob Cameron’s resemblance to a bad head cold. The entire Battle of Freeman’s Farm was a creative masterpiece, including it’s portrayal through the British perspective, so stay tuned for Chelsea's thoughts on that as well.
